The real significance of 3K, however, is not found in the living room but in the mastering suite and the cinema projector. The digital cinema standard DCI 2K (2048 x 1080) has long been the workhorse of theatrical projection. Yet, many films are shot and mastered in DCI 3K or even 4K. Why? The answer lies in reframing and post-production stability. A 3K master allows editors and colorists to zoom into a shot by 25% without losing a single pixel of the final 2K output. It provides a safety margin for digital stabilization and open-matte reframing for different aspect ratios. Streaming a 4K movie requires a massive, ultra-stable internet connection—usually a minimum of 25 Mbps. For users with data caps or slower broadband, 4K streaming can lead to constant buffering. 3K HD movies offer a visual experience that is virtually indistinguishable from 4K on screens under 30 inches, while requiring significantly less data bandwidth. 3. Standard web browsers sometimes cap video playback at 1080p to save data. To get true high-definition 3K playback, use dedicated media applications like VLC Media Player, PotPlayer, or official desktop streaming apps that allow you to manually select the highest available bitrate and resolution.
